After loading on a link to KnightNews, all of the header stuff disappeared - Firefox box, minimize button, delete button, and the only way to get out of the KnightNews was control-alt-delete. I now find that any time i use Firefox, I have the same problem. I have deleted the program, reinstalled it, done a system restore, all to no avail. When I click on Firefox to open it, the full window appears briefly, then the whole screen is filled with the opening Firefox page. Clicking on a program in the history box brings it up, but it's the same scenario - control-alt-delete is the only way to get out. I also was not able to open the Troubleshooting Information which was listed below on this page.

Do you get any toolbars showing if you move the mouse pointer to the top of the window?

If you are in full screen mode then hover the mouse to the top of the screen to make the Navigation Toolbar and Tab bar appear. Click the Maximize button (top right corner of the Navigation Toolbar) to leave full screen mode or right-click empty space on a toolbar and choose "Exit Full Screen Mode" or press the F11 key.

Do you get the system menu via Alt + Space?

You can check for problems caused by a corrupted localstore.rdf file.

Try the Firefox SafeMode to see how it works there.
A troubleshooting mode, which disables most Add-ons.
Troubleshoot Firefox issues using Firefox SafeMode

  • You can open the Firefox 15.0+ SafeMode by holding the Shft key when you use the Firefox desktop or Start menu shortcut.

To exit the Firefox Safe Mode, just close Firefox and wait a few seconds before using the Firefox shortcut (without the Shft key) to open it again.


If it is good in the Firefox SafeMode, your problem is probably caused by an extension, and you need to figure out which one.
http://support.mozilla.com/en-US/kb/troubleshooting+extensions+and+themes
Or it might be caused by Hardware Acceleration.

Create a new profile as a test to check if your current profile is causing the problems.

See "Creating a profile":

If the new profile works then you can transfer some files from an existing profile to the new profile, but be cautious not to copy corrupted files to avoid carrying over the problem.
